Output 0c0c511891fa494de8db5bca055bc8bdd360577f2f11884b8935b4e7230b46f6:1

value
18569
script pubkey
OP_0 OP_PUSHBYTES_20 3960703581e8c54812a5e391f9cbdb42a842e846
address
bc1q89s8qdvparz5sy49uwglnj7mg25y96zxn9wp4y
transaction
0c0c511891fa494de8db5bca055bc8bdd360577f2f11884b8935b4e7230b46f6
confirmations
22899
spent
true